1 definition by Angie (I love you Karen)

Top Definition
something that doctors or lab techs do to people who are required to do so in the process of finding an "Answer" to their medical whoa's. This process is done with some sort of needle, which can be quite painful and annoying, perhaps leaving track marks up and down the inside of your elbow or inbow
Karen had high blood sugar when she was pregnant, therefore the doctor felt the need to JAB her with a needle to take some of her blood.
by Angie (I love you Karen) March 10, 2006

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.